Subject: On-call prep — zero-downtime migrations

Hi, and welcome to the Tidemark platform team. While on call, you may be paged during a schema migration. We never lock tables in production: every migration follows our expand-migrate-contract pattern, and each phase is independently reversible. Please do not improvise — even a small manual ALTER can break the dual-write layer. The full procedure, including rollback steps, is here:

wiki page, tahaf-tajog: https://jira.ordindyn.corp/pipeline

Subject: DR drill next Thursday — user module carve-out

Hey, quick heads-up before you review the plan. We're running the disaster-recovery drill for Brindlewick's monolith split, specifically the new user module service. If the failover stalls, the runbook says to restore the standby vault snapshot and re-seed sessions manually. Tam will shadow the whole thing and log timings. For the restore step, you'll need the recovery passphrase, which I'm pasting right below so it's handy.

strongbox words: praael-weneth-eliys-istwyn-fenok-rusox-praath-rusael-norwyn

Ticket #112: Door sensor recall. Vendor Quellmark has recalled the QX-series sensors fitted on floors 2 and 4 of Bramfield House. Affected doors will fail open until replacements arrive Thursday. Assistants: do not prop these doors; security will patrol hourly. Log any sensor fault to the facilities queue, not to Quellmark directly. Meeting-room bookings on those floors are unaffected. Until the swap is complete, staff on 2 and 4 should enter via the atrium using the interim pass shown below.

staff pass of yagep-tajep = bdg-TRT-1

## Plugin authors: fuel-usage report hooks

Welcome aboard! The Drayvard fleet fuel-usage report runs nightly and exposes a post-aggregation hook your plugin can subscribe to. Keep handlers under two seconds — slow hooks get dropped, no retries. During development you'll use the sandbox fleet, which resets weekly. To unlock the sandbox reporting console after a reset, enter the recovery passphrase shown directly below.

unlock words, bahop-fawef: novmir-druwyn-soriel-rusdor-kasion